Plant-based Nachos! We definitely enjoy grabbing lunch from this restaurant. We ordered their Not so Little Chicken Sandwich, Neutron Nachos, and Reactor Melt. Very happy that Disney offers solid plant-based options. The nachos were delicious. The blue corn tortillas are a creative touch. We also enjoyed the Reactor Melt. The pesto spread elevates this grilled cheese sandwich. The tater tots that accompany it were crunchy. We also got the Not so Little Chicken Sandwich which was a good choice as well but we preferred the chicken sandwich from Lucky Fortune Cookery. The location is in an entertaining area of California Adventure. Lots happening all around from character meet ups, attraction rides, shopping, restrooms, and character performances as well. And if you need an alcoholic beverage, you can get one at Pym’s Testing Lab. Definitely recommend using the mobile option to place your order.

Pym Test Kitchen is a restaurant located at 1313 Disneyland Dr, Anaheim, CA 92802, United States.
What are the opening hours for Pym Test Kitchen?
Pym Test Kitchen is open daily from 8:00 AM to 9:00 PM.
Does Pym Test Kitchen serve breakfast, lunch, and dinner?
Yes, the restaurant serves breakfast, lunch, and dinner.
Can I find a children's menu at Pym Test Kitchen?
Yes, Pym Test Kitchen offers a children's menu.
Are reservations required or accepted at Pym Test Kitchen?
Pym Test Kitchen neither requires nor accepts reservations.
What payment options are available at Pym Test Kitchen?
You can pay by American Express, Cash, Contactless Payment, Diners Club, Discover, Mastercard, and Visa at Pym Test Kitchen.
Does Pym Test Kitchen offer takeout or order ahead services?
Yes, Pym Test Kitchen has takeout available and supports order and pay ahead services.
Is Pym Test Kitchen wheelchair accessible?
Yes, the restaurant has wheelchair accessible entrance, parking, seating, and restrooms.
What nearby attractions can I visit before or after dining at Pym Test Kitchen?
You can visit nearby attractions such as Avengers Campus, Guardians of the Galaxy: Mission Breakout, and Disney Animation for an entertaining experience before or after your meal.
Are there other dining or shopping options near Pym Test Kitchen?
Yes, nearby you can find other restaurants like Shawarma Palace and Terran Treats, and gift shops such as Avengers Vault and Campus Supply Pod for shopping.
